Sbarro in Arcadia, OH
Find the data you're looking for about the Arcadia, OH Sbarro locations. Learn about free delivery, gluten-free pizza, and the best pizzerias in the Arcadia, Ohio region.
Sbarro Listings
<< |
< |
1 | > |
>>
Page 1 of 1
Showing 1 - 14 of 14